About Lussan in Provence Gard, Provence - Cote d'Azur
This is Provence as it used to be: unspoiled, uncrowded - just lovely. Perfect in summer - vibrant and lively with constant clear blue sky and warm temparatures. However, it is at its loveliest out of season with an abundance of pure clear air and light. Even in winter the sun continues to shine most of the time. If you are looking for somewhere inspirational to take time out to write, paint or just "be", come and visit us for an extended stay between October and the end of May and become part of the real Provençal way of life.
Easily accessible from Montpellier, Nîmes and Marseilles airports, equidistant between Nîmes and Avignon, Lussan provides a perfect holiday location for all interests.
Within the village there is a post office, small general shop and two restaurants,. Fresh baguettes, croissants and pastries are delivered straight from the oven to the basket on your front door every day; free-range organic eggs from our own chickens and other organic produce avilable
The nearest town, Uzès - France's oldest duchy - is about 15km south of Lussan and here can be found many cafes and open air restaurants as well as the famous Saturday market. The vibrant cities of Avignon, Nîmes and Orange, with their Roman sights and internationally-acclaimed music festivals are about 45 minutes drive. The spectacular Pont du Gard, a Unesco World Heritage site, is only 20 minutes drive away.
For wildlife enthusiasts the area abounds in unique habitats; the mas itself sits in 7 acres of of gorgeous gardens and unspoilt meadowland, alive with colourful butterflies attracted by the wild herbs typical of Provence, as well as rare bee orchids in the spring. Regular visitors also include kites, buzzards, eagles, vultures, wild boar and a host of other wildlife. The wild open spaces of the Camargue, famous for its white horses and pink flamingos, are about 75 minutes away.
Off season the area can be seen at its very best, with spring and autumn being particularly beautiful, and winter very short - cold but sunny. Extended off-season lets will appeal particularly to bird-watching enthusiasts, where the spring and autumn migrating periods are of particular interest. With an abundance of pure, clear Provencal light, the quieter off-season months will attract artists or anyone just wishing to experience the "real" France.

How To Get To Lussan in Provence Gard, South of France and the Riviera
Fly Threre are airports at Avignon, Nimes, Marseille, and Montpellier - all within a 90 minute drive. Ryanair, Easyjet, Flybe and BA all fly to these from most UK regional airports. International flights to Paris, Lyon and Nice all have easy connections by rail
Train - take the Eurostar from London Waterloo to Lille, then change to the TGV direct to either Avignon or Nîmes ( direct on Eurostar London – Avignon in the summer).
Whichever way you travel, a car is essential. Best to make arrangements before you leave, but cars can be hired from all airports and TGV stations.
By car - Lussan is approximately 1,000 km from Calais and about 40 minutes from the Bollène exit of the A7. Full instructions and a map of the area will be sent to you on receipt of the booking deposit.
